Transaction 0859ee8dd79659fd90dff5bbe91411a24691d1a16f1d32d0044451f73842efa9
1 Input
2 Outputs
- 0859ee8dd79659fd90dff5bbe91411a24691d1a16f1d32d0044451f73842efa9:0
- 0859ee8dd79659fd90dff5bbe91411a24691d1a16f1d32d0044451f73842efa9:1
value 3526230
address 3HDVxZJwi245XgQkVFw54xDoCWLdUumGJd
value 46000
address 3QwYEgHWX7oqSRbfS5cSKfCFkEJ3e1cFsC